Looking for a restaurant within walking distance of the Marriott Stellaris- nothing real fancy or expensive - more mid priced with some local food.

 

Also need a liquor store nearby to pick up some beer for ship.

 

If you exit the hotel, cross the street, and turn to your left a short distance, you will come to one of our favorite places in San Juan for Mexican food. It is called Tequilas (close spelling anyway:confused:), and there is seating indoor or out. Warning though...portions are huge! Next time we will share.

 

Continue farther down the steet another block or two and on the same side of the street as the Marriott, you will find a small liquor store that has some wine and beer.

We love staying at the Stellaris pre/post cruise and love a restaurant nearby called "Danny's". It serves mostly Italian foods, including fabulous pizza, but has a very extensive menu. It is less than a block from the Marriott. You walk out the hotel, go left at the street and stay on the left-hand side. Danny's is right there. I'm not familiar with the liquor store referenced, but know that there is also a ice cream/coffee shop across the street with free wireless internet and serves a decent breakfast in the mornings.
